The Truth About Baking Soda and Septic Tanks

When it comes to septic systems, understanding their function is crucial for effective maintenance. A septic tank is designed to treat wastewater from your home, relying on a combination of physical and biological processes to break down solids and eliminate harmful pathogens. At the heart of this system are bacteria—both aerobic and anaerobic—that play a vital role in decomposing organic matter.

How Septic Systems Work

Septic systems consist of several components that work together to treat wastewater:


  • Septic Tank: This underground container holds wastewater, allowing solids to settle at the bottom while lighter materials float to the top.

  • Drain Field: After treatment in the tank, liquid effluent is released into the drain field, where it percolates through soil, further filtering out contaminants.

  • Bacteria: The key players in the breakdown of waste, bacteria help decompose solids and convert harmful substances into harmless byproducts.

Maintaining a healthy balance of bacteria is essential for the system’s efficiency. Any disruption to this microbial community can lead to system failures, backups, and costly repairs.

What is Baking Soda?

Baking soda, or sodium bicarbonate, is a common household item known for its versatility. It’s often used in cooking, cleaning, and even as a deodorizer. Its chemical properties allow it to neutralize acids, which is why some people consider it a potential ally in maintaining septic systems.

Potential Benefits of Baking Soda in Septic Tanks

Some advocates suggest that adding baking soda to a septic tank can offer several benefits:


  1. pH Regulation: Baking soda can help neutralize acidic conditions, potentially creating a more favorable environment for bacteria.

  2. Odor Control: Its deodorizing properties may help mitigate unpleasant smells emanating from the septic system.

  3. Encouraging Bacterial Growth: Some believe that the introduction of baking soda can promote the growth of beneficial bacteria, aiding in waste decomposition.

While these benefits sound appealing, it’s essential to approach them with caution.

Potential Drawbacks of Using Baking Soda

Despite the potential advantages, there are significant risks associated with adding baking soda to a septic tank:


  • Disruption of Bacterial Balance: Introducing baking soda can alter the pH levels too drastically, potentially harming the very bacteria that are essential for waste breakdown.

  • Overuse Risks: Regularly adding baking soda may lead to an accumulation that could overwhelm the septic system, causing more harm than good.

  • False Sense of Security: Relying on baking soda as a solution might lead homeowners to neglect other critical maintenance tasks, such as regular pumping and inspections.

Expert Opinions

Many septic system professionals advise against using baking soda in septic tanks. They emphasize that the best way to maintain a healthy septic system is through regular maintenance practices, such as:


  1. Regular pumping of the septic tank (typically every 3-5 years).

  2. Avoiding flushing non-biodegradable items down the toilet.

  3. Using septic-safe products for cleaning and personal care.

In summary, while baking soda may offer some benefits, the potential risks and the importance of maintaining a balanced ecosystem in your septic tank cannot be overlooked. Understanding the intricacies of your septic system will ultimately guide you in making informed decisions about its care and maintenance.

Actionable Recommendations for Septic Tank Maintenance

Maintaining a septic tank is crucial for its longevity and efficiency. While the idea of using baking soda may seem appealing, there are better practices to ensure your septic system remains in optimal condition. Below are actionable recommendations that can help you manage your septic tank effectively.

Regular Maintenance Practices

To keep your septic system functioning properly, consider the following maintenance practices:


  1. Schedule Regular Pumping:

    • Have your septic tank pumped every 3 to 5 years, depending on household size and usage.

    • Regular pumping prevents sludge buildup, which can lead to system failure.



  2. Inspect Your System:

    • Conduct regular inspections to identify any potential issues early.

    • Look for signs of leaks, odors, or slow drains.



  3. Maintain Drain Field Health:

    • Avoid parking or driving on the drain field to prevent soil compaction.

    • Keep the area around the drain field clear of trees and shrubs to prevent root intrusion.

Best Practices for Waste Disposal

How you dispose of waste can significantly impact your septic system. Follow these guidelines:


  • Use Septic-Safe Products:

    • Choose cleaning products and personal care items labeled as septic-safe.

    • Avoid harsh chemicals that can kill beneficial bacteria.



  • Limit Water Usage:

    • Spread out laundry and dishwashing over the week to avoid overwhelming the system.

    • Install water-efficient fixtures to reduce overall water consumption.



  • Be Mindful of Flushing:

    • Only flush human waste and toilet paper; avoid flushing items like wipes, feminine products, or dental floss.

    • Educate family members about what can and cannot be flushed.



Monitoring and Troubleshooting

Keeping an eye on your septic system can help catch issues before they escalate:


  1. Watch for Warning Signs:

    • Be alert for gurgling sounds in pipes, slow drains, or standing water around the drain field.

    • Notice any unusual odors, which could indicate a problem.



  2. Keep Records:

    • Maintain a log of all maintenance activities, including pumping dates and inspections.

    • Document any issues and repairs for future reference.
